Turbo\u015farj geli\u015ftirilmi\u015f s\u00fcr\u00fc\u015f keyfi i\u00e7in i\u00e7ten yanmal\u0131 motorlara eklenerek, motorun g\u00fcc\u00fcn\u00fc artt\u0131rmaya y\u00f6neliktir. K\u00f6t\u00fc kullan\u0131l\u0131p, k\u00f6t\u00fc tamir edilirse bir\u00e7ok probleme yol a\u00e7ar. Dizel ve gaz motoru kullan\u0131c\u0131lar\u0131 bu ger\u00e7e\u011fin fark\u0131ndad\u0131r.<\/p>\n<p>Ayr\u0131ca t\u00fcrbin olarak adland\u0131r\u0131lan turbo, yeni nesil motorlar\u0131n ayr\u0131lmaz par\u00e7alar\u0131ndan biri haline gelmi\u015ftir. Bu pistonlara bas\u0131n\u00e7l\u0131 hava g\u00f6nderilmesini egzoz gaz\u0131n\u0131n kinetik enerjisinden alan bir sistemdir. Sistem \u015fu \u015fekilde \u00e7al\u0131\u015f\u0131r: egzoz gaz\u0131 yava\u015flar, milli pervanelerin ak\u0131\u015f y\u00f6n\u00fcn\u00fc de\u011fi\u015ftirir ve ayn\u0131 \u015faft\u0131 payla\u015fan emme pervanesini s\u00fcrer. S\u0131k\u0131\u015ft\u0131r\u0131lm\u0131\u015f oksijence bol hava daha b\u00fcy\u00fck miktardaki yak\u0131t yak\u0131m\u0131 demektir. Bu yak\u0131t yak\u0131m verimlili\u011fini artt\u0131r\u0131r, yak\u0131t tasarrufu sa\u011flar ve y\u00fckseltilmi\u015f oksijen seviyesi yak\u0131t ak\u0131\u015f h\u0131z\u0131n\u0131 artt\u0131r\u0131r. Bu sayede motor hacmini y\u00fckseltmeden turbosuz motorlara k\u0131yasla daha y\u00fcksek g\u00fc\u00e7 sa\u011flan\u0131r. Modern turbolar yakla\u015f\u0131k olarak 800 \u00b0C ve 250000 devir\/dk h\u0131zda \u00e7al\u0131\u015f\u0131rlar. Y\u00fcksek h\u0131z sebebiyle, rotor yatak k\u0131za\u011f\u0131 motor ya\u011f\u0131 ile ya\u011flan\u0131r.<\/p>\n<p><strong>turbina maleTurbolar<\/strong>; Garrett, Holset, IHI, Mitsubishi, Borg Warner(3K &#038; Schwitzer), Toyota ve Hitachi gibi \u015firketler taraf\u0131ndan \u00fcretilmektedir. \u015eu anda, halk dilinde nozul halkal\u0131 turbo olarak bilinen VNT turbolar \u00e7ok pop\u00fcler. Bu turbolar, motor devrine ba\u011fl\u0131 olarak t\u00fcrbine gaz ak\u0131\u015f\u0131n\u0131 sa\u011flayan hareketli nozul halkas\u0131 kullan\u0131r. Bu uygulamada turbo-lag olarak adland\u0131r\u0131lan gaz pedal\u0131na bas\u0131m ile turbin( ayr\u0131ca motor) tepkisi aras\u0131ndaki gecikmeyi minimize eder. Bunlardan birisi t\u00fcrbin\/ kompres\u00f6r g\u00f6vdesine demir tozu, kum gibi yabanc\u0131 maddelerin girmesidir. Turbonun \u00e7al\u0131\u015fma ko\u015fullar\u0131nda, herhangi bir yabanc\u0131 madde, \u00e7ark kanatlar\u0131nda k\u0131r\u0131lmalara ve b\u00fck\u00fclmelere sebep olabilir. En k\u00f6t\u00fc durumda, bu yabanc\u0131 materyal turbonun tamamen durmas\u0131na zarar g\u00f6rmesine sebebiyet verir. G\u00f6vdede mil yata\u011f\u0131nda ya\u011flama gerektiren elemanlar\u0131n herhangi bir sebepten \u00f6t\u00fcr\u00fc ya\u011flanmamas\u0131 da ayr\u0131ca turbo i\u00e7in tehlikelidir. Ya\u011f ak\u0131\u015f\u0131ndaki birka\u00e7 saniyelik durma \u015faftta, bur\u00e7 yataklar\u0131na ve katri\u00e7 g\u00f6vdesinde ciddi a\u015f\u0131nmalara sebebiyet verir. Ya\u011f safl\u0131\u011f\u0131 turbo \u00f6mr\u00fc i\u00e7in \u00f6nem ta\u015f\u0131maktad\u0131r. Ya\u011fdaki kirlenme ar\u0131zaya sebebiyet verir. 10 sn den fazla s\u00fcren uygunsuz ya\u011flama bas\u0131nc\u0131 a\u015f\u0131r\u0131 \u0131s\u0131nmaya ve t\u00fcm turbonun tahribine neden olur. Turbolu ara\u00e7 kullan\u0131m tekni\u011fi olduk\u00e7a \u00f6nemlidir. Motoru \u00e7al\u0131\u015ft\u0131rd\u0131ktan sonra bir s\u00fcre r\u00f6lantide tutmal\u0131s\u0131n\u0131z. S\u00fcr\u00fc\u015f s\u0131ras\u0131nda, birimler \u0131s\u0131nd\u0131ktan sonra motorun orta ya da y\u00fcksek h\u0131zda tutulmas\u0131 \u00f6nerilir. Motor kapat\u0131l\u0131p ya\u011f pompas\u0131 durdu\u011funda, hala y\u00fcksek h\u0131zdaki \u00e7al\u0131\u015fan rotor i\u00e7indeki mil yata\u011f\u0131n\u0131n ya\u011flanmas\u0131 kesilir. Bu arada, mil yata\u011f\u0131n\u0131 besleyen \u0131s\u0131nm\u0131\u015f ya\u011f kal\u0131nt\u0131lar\u0131 k\u00f6m\u00fcrle\u015fmeye sebep olur. Mil yata\u011f\u0131n\u0131n \u00e7izilmesine sebebiyet veren par\u00e7ac\u0131klar olu\u015fmu\u015f olur. Motorunuzu kapatmadan \u00f6nce birka\u00e7 saniye d\u00fc\u015f\u00fck devirde tutmal\u0131s\u0131n\u0131z. Bu t\u00fcrbin h\u0131z\u0131n\u0131n yava\u015flamas\u0131na ve yataklardaki bozulmalar\u0131n azalmas\u0131na neden olur. D\u00fczg\u00fcn \u00e7al\u0131\u015fmayan turbolar nas\u0131l tamir edilmelidir? Hat\u0131rlamal\u0131s\u0131n\u0131z ki turbolar belirli d\u00fczeyde tolerans ile \u00fcretilen y\u00fcksek hassasiyetli cihazlard\u0131r. Konusunda uzmanla\u015fm\u0131\u015f uzmanlar taraf\u0131ndan tamir edilmelidir. Rejenerasyon s\u00fcresince, turbo tamamen s\u00f6k\u00fcl\u00fcr ve ultrasonik y\u0131kay\u0131c\u0131larda \u00f6zel makinelerle y\u0131kan\u0131r. Temizlik ile kir \u015faft ve emme pervanesinden tamamen temizlenir ve en \u00f6nemlisi de g\u00f6vdede ki ya\u011f kanallar\u0131 a\u00e7\u0131l\u0131r. Rulmanlar, segmanlar gibi par\u00e7alar sonradan de\u011fi\u015ftirilir. Hasarl\u0131 \u015faft ya da emme pervanesi de de\u011fi\u015ftirilebilir. Rotorlar 250000 rpm h\u0131zlarla d\u00f6nerler, bu nedenle uygun balanslama turbo yenilemenin en \u00f6nemli a\u015famas\u0131ndan biridir.
